Ok so i recently purchased all 6 (was cheaper to get them all together :P) And started watching A new hope again. But one thing has struck me only now... In Episode 1-3 C3po and R2-D2 go along with anakin to Tatooine and meet Anakins mother and her new husband (forget the name) and there son owen.. they visit the farm, and even at the last scene of Episode 3 (if i am not mistaken). So why in A new hope do they know nothing off the place... they don't even question Luke SKYWALKER. :P Only now that i have watched the first 3 episodes is this striking me as odd :lol: anyone have a explanation? memory wipe or something... or just generally covering it up.

I have a question too!

how did they managed to have the same Anakin from episode 3 at the ending of the final movie (Return of the Jedi) when the first 3 weren't even made and the movie was released 2 decades before episode 3? He looks exactly the same, face, hair, etc.

you watched the remastered version, where they literally chopped Hayden into that scene, originally it was someone else.
